THREE KINGS DAY

Image
Three Kings day is a celebration that is very similar to Christmas.....but instead of Santa bringing presents it is the Three Kings that went to visit baby Jesus. This holiday is celebrated on the 6th of January every year. It is widely celebrated in Spain and Latin American countries. My parents are from the Caribbean, where this holiday is popular. We currently live in the United States where this holiday is not as popular or well known. So to get back to our roots I suggested last year that we celebrate this holiday.
